Overview

Introducing the 2023 Bajaj Pulsar N250—a striking naked bike that captures the essence of urban agility and spirited performance. Positioned as an entry-level powerhouse in Bajaj's renowned Pulsar lineup, the N250 is designed for riders who crave both a thrilling ride and everyday practicality. With its aggressive styling and modern features, the Pulsar N250 not only turns heads but also delivers a compelling blend of performance and comfort, making it a perfect companion for daily commutes and weekend adventures alike. At the heart of the Pulsar N250 lies a potent 249.7 cc engine, generating an impressive 24.1 HP at 8750 RPM and a robust torque of 21.5 Nm at 6500 RPM. This strong power delivery ensures exhilarating acceleration, whether darting through city traffic or enjoying winding roads. The bike's 5-speed gearbox offers smooth shifts, allowing riders to tap into the engine's capabilities effortlessly. The cooling system, a combination of oil and air, maintains optimal engine temperatures for consistent performance. With a weight of just 162 kg, the Pulsar N250 boasts an agile and responsive handling experience, enhanced by its double cradle frame and well-tuned suspension that absorbs bumps with ease. The Pulsar N250 is packed with features that cater to the modern motorcyclist. Its advanced fuel injection system ensures efficient combustion, promoting both power and fuel economy. This bike also comes equipped with an ABS-enabled braking system, featuring a 300 mm front disc and a 230 mm rear disc, delivering confidence-inspiring stopping power. Riders will appreciate the comfortable seat height of 795 mm, ideal for both shorter and taller riders, along with a ground clearance of 165 mm that navigates urban obstacles with ease. Available in vibrant colors like Techno Grey, Racing Red, and Caribbean Blue, the Pulsar N250 is as stylish as it is functional. **

Pros

  • Powerful Engine: The 249.7 cc engine provides a thrilling ride with strong acceleration and torque.
  • Agile Handling: Lightweight design and responsive suspension make it easy to maneuver in traffic and tackle corners.
  • Modern Features: ABS brakes and a fuel injection system enhance safety and efficiency, catering to the needs of today's riders.

Cons

  • Limited Performance for Highway Cruising: While excellent for city rides, it may feel less comfortable during extended high-speed rides on highways.
  • Seat Comfort: The seat could be improved for longer journeys, as it may not provide the best comfort for extended riding.
  • Market Availability: Currently, the Pulsar N250 is primarily sold in India, limiting access for international buyers who may be interested in this model.
